Chapter 22: Introduction to IoT security and the PSA Certified™ framework

Abstract

This chapter introduces the PSA Certified scheme, explains what it means for IoT product development, details PSA Certified Levels 1, 2, and 3 and also details the PSA Functional API Certification. It also covers the Trusted Firmware-M (TF-M) project, an open-source project, which provides reference implementation software (i.e., Secure firmware) for Arm(R) Cortex(R)-M-based devices.

Keywords

Platform Security Architecture (PSA); PSA Certified; Trusted Firmware; Trust Base System Architecture; Interprocess communication (IPC); PSA Functional APIs
